The partnership between Queensberry Promotions and DAZN has been met with enthusiasm from boxing fans and industry insiders. Frank Warren, the head of Queensberry, expressed excitement about the collaboration, highlighting DAZN's commitment to boxing and its ability to provide a one-stop platform for fans. The deal ensures that Queensberry's fighters, including Tyson Fury, Moses Itauma, and Fabio Wardley, will now be showcased exclusively on DAZN. The move is seen as a major shift in boxing broadcasting, consolidating top-tier talent under DAZN's umbrella alongside promotions like Matchroom and Golden Boy. Fans have welcomed the convenience of accessing multiple promotions in one place, while Warren emphasized the global reach this partnership offers.
